ASSISTING PEOPLE IN CRISIS THROUGH ACTS OF PRACTICAL SERVICE. THIS IS TO IMPROVE HEALTHY LIVING BY SUPPORTING PERSONAL RESTORATION AS WELL AS ENCOURAGING COMMUNITY OPPORTUNITIES TO ASSIST THOSE IN TRANSITION FROM SLAVERY PROSTITUTION AND OTHER FORMS OF BONDAGE. ERADICATING SEXUAL EXPLOITATION & TRAFFICKING THROUGH THE 'H.O.P.E. MODEL': (PHYSICALLY MENTALLY EMOTIONALLY AND SPIRITUALLY)_ BY PROVIDING: RECOVERY PROGRAMS SUPPORT GROUPS MENTORSHIP ACCESS TO TRANSITIONAL HOUSING ARE CASE PLANNING. OUTREACH - COMPASSION EMPATHY HOLISTIC SUPPORT AND CARING INTERVENTION THROUGH THE FOLLOWING: REFERRALS OUTREACH WORKERS AND ACCESS TO INDIVIDUALIZED SOCIAL SUPPORTS AND EXIT STRATEGIES. PARTNERSHIP - FORMAL AND INFORMAL RELATIONSHIPS WITH: AFFILIATE ORGANIZATIONS SERVICE PROVIDERS FUNDERS AND MEMBERS. EDUCATION - INFORMING AND INFLUENCING INDIVIDUALS ABOUT THE SYSTEMIC AND SYSTEMATIC CAUSES AND EFFECTS OF SEXUAL EXPLOITATION AND TRAFFICKING.

Over the years

Every figure as filed at each fiscal period end, 20192024.

Period endRevenueCents to causeOverheadReserves
2019-12-31$107K85¢15%0.5 yr
2020-12-31$207K85¢15%0.6 yr
2021-12-31$380K92¢8%0.3 yr
2022-12-31$545K83¢17%1 yr
2023-12-31$839K89¢11%1 yr
2024-12-31$1.0M91¢9%1 yr
